安装 Node.js

Node.js 是一个 JavaScript 运行环境,是安装 Claude Code、Codex CLI 等命令行工具的前置依赖。本教程将带你从零开始安装 Node.js。

版本要求

  • 最低版本:Node.js 18+
  • 推荐版本:Node.js 22 LTS(长期支持版)
什么是 LTS?

LTS(Long Term Support)是长期支持版本,稳定性更高,推荐大部分用户使用。

安装步骤

macOS
Windows
Linux

方法一:官网下载安装包(推荐新手)

第 1 步:访问 Node.js 官网

打开浏览器,访问 https://nodejs.org/zh-cn/download

第 2 步:下载安装包

选择自己电脑的平台(ARM64或X64),点击下载按钮。

Node.js 安装包下载

第 3 步:运行安装包

双击下载好的 .pkg 文件,按照安装向导一步步操作即可。

第 4 步:验证安装

打开「终端」应用(在「启动台」→「其他」中找到,或按 Cmd + 空格 搜索「终端」),输入以下命令:

node -v

如果看到类似 v22.x.x 的版本号,说明安装成功。同时验证 npm:

npm -v

验证版本

方法二:使用 Homebrew 安装(推荐有经验的用户)

如果你已经安装了 Homebrew,可以直接在终端运行:

brew install node

安装完成后验证:

node -v
npm -v
还没安装 Homebrew?

在终端中运行以下命令安装 Homebrew: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

安装完成后按照终端提示配置环境变量,然后再安装 Node.js。

常见问题

npm 安装全局包时提示权限不足(macOS/Linux)

如果在运行 npm install -g 时遇到权限问题,可以尝试:

sudo npm install -g <package-name>

或者配置 npm 的全局安装路径(推荐):

mkdir -p ~/.npm-global
npm config set prefix '~/.npm-global'

然后将以下内容添加到你的 shell 配置文件(~/.bashrc~/.zshrc):

export PATH=~/.npm-global/bin:$PATH

重新加载配置:

source ~/.zshrc  # 或 source ~/.bashrc

下一步

Node.js 安装完成后,你可以继续安装 AI 工具: